There isnt really a way to tell how many "Krush's" for instance are on a server, the OP was probably just meaning that they haven't seen many on the server, or else maybe they just listen to bad information. Its impossible to pole all the hunters to see who or who doesnt have him. Back when CATA came out and you tamed Terrorpene 14 hours after release, you could probably say "server first or second", but since WOTLK came out a couple years ago there's likely hundreds of King Krush pets out there, just some people rarely take them out of their stables with all the new shineys that are around (like me for instance).


But yeah, I recommend sticking to that (3 rares up at a time) theory, if you kill a rare another will spawn somewhere on the continent ~15 or so minutes later. I once "put to sleep" Skoll while I was camping for TLPD (no one else wanted him, Frozen Lake spawn point) and that actually caused TLPD to spawn 10-20 minutes later to my enjoyment :)

Sorry to hear about that tale, happy it worked out for you :)

~Kylok, NPCSCAN and NPCSCAN Overlay are 2 necessities these days for any rare-hunter. Also Silverdragon isnt bad to have as a backup, but it usually ends up just giving me a large box of error message that makes taming the rare much harder :(


Top of the hour/ bottom of the hour have nothing to do with spawn times, they could however be the lucky times for you to look :), BUT if your mob isnt there, you may be able to "force" it to spawn (as long as its been 6 hours ish at least) by doing other laps to look for a different rare to kill.
